Ty Lue should've had Zubac covering the passer (Crowder)....and Cousins in the paint covering Ayton for the lob.
To Crowder's credit, it took a perfect alley oop pass by him, and he came through. Also took a great screen by Booker on Zubac to free up Ayton at that precise split fraction of a second to give him just enough time to get to that ball waiting for him at the rim..and they both came through. The other 2 Sun's players performed their assigned roles perfectly too...as away from the play decoys.

I don’t know

They could have gone zone with a lineup like that to take away the lob. But then you risk giving up an open catch and shot on the perimeter.

.9 seconds is plenty of time for the offense to get a quality look.

Personally, I don’t think both Cousins and Zubac should be on the floor there because they can’t move well enough to cover. 1 guarding the inbounded is good, but both really limits options to play man defense.
